EXPIRED – Flood Advisory for Parts of St. Clair & Shelby Counties Until 7 pm

| July 20, 2021 @ 4:03 pm

The National Weather Service in Birmingham has issued a

* Urban and Small Stream Flood Advisory for…
Southwestern St. Clair County in central Alabama…
Northeastern Shelby County in central Alabama…

* Until 700 PM CDT.

* At 400 PM CDT, Doppler radar indicated heavy rain due to
thunderstorms. This will cause urban and small stream flooding.
Between 1 and 2 inches of rain have fallen so far. Heavy rain will
continue from this slow-moving storm.

* Some locations that will experience flooding include…
Pell City, Leeds, Moody, Vincent, Vandiver, Bald Rock, Coosa
Island, Harrisburg, Logan Martin Lake, Camp Winnataska, Sterrett
and Chula Vista.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S…

Turn around, don’t dr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ood
deaths occur in vehicles.
